Transaction 65a2e18db3230071bacf8a02e10c5f5bf4abb79b53f9ff105dd98ae19ae6f7b8
1 Input
1 Output
-
65a2e18db3230071bacf8a02e10c5f5bf4abb79b53f9ff105dd98ae19ae6f7b8:0
- value
- 98705
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 9156e4e5206ec125568a9fda29b37f853b3a771d OP_EQUAL
- address
- 3EwVzsL4BcGjVLFmEtWWk2jvSVg5v59yE7